# Unit Testing Security and Authorization
## Overview
This skill provides patterns for unit testing Spring Security authorization logic using @PreAuthorize, @Secured, @RolesAllowed, and custom permission evaluators. It covers testing role-based access control (RBAC), expression-based authorization, custom permission evaluators, and verifying access denied scenarios without full Spring Security context.

## Instructions
Follow these steps to test Spring Security authorization:
### 1. Set Up Security Testing Dependencies
Add spring-security-test to your test dependencies along with JUnit 5 and AssertJ.
### 2. Enable Method Security in Configuration
Use @EnableGlobalMethodSecurity(prePostEnabled = true) to activate @PreAuthorize annotations.
### 3. Create Test with @WithMockUser
Apply @WithMockUser annotation to simulate authenticated users with specific roles and authorities.
### 4. Test Both Allow and Deny Scenarios
For each security rule, test that authorized users can access the method and unauthorized users receive AccessDeniedException.
### 5. Test Expression-Based Authorization
Verify complex expressions like authentication.principal.username == #owner work correctly.
### 6. Test Custom Permission Evaluators
Unit test custom PermissionEvaluator implementations by creating Authentication objects and calling hasPermission directly.
### 7. Verify Method Interactions
Mock external dependencies and verify that security checks don't interfere with business logic.

## Setup: Security Testing
### Maven
```xml
<dependency>
<groupId>org.springframework.boot</groupId>
<artifactId>spring-boot-starter-security</artifactId>
</dependency>
<dependency>
<groupId>org.springframework.boot</groupId>
<artifactId>spring-boot-starter-test</artifactId>
<scope>test</scope>
</dependency>
<dependency>
<groupId>org.springframework.security</groupId>
<artifactId>spring-security-test</artifactId>
<scope>test</scope>
</dependency>
```
### Gradle
```kotlin
dependencies {
implementation("org.springframework.boot:spring-boot-starter-security")
testImplementation("org.springframework.boot:spring-boot-starter-test")
testImplementation("org.springframework.security:spring-security-test")
}
```
## Basic Pattern: Testing @PreAuthorize
### Simple Role-Based Access Control
```java
// Service with security annotations
@Service
public class UserService {
@PreAuthorize("hasRole('ADMIN')")
public void deleteUser(Long userId) {
// delete logic
}
@PreAuthorize("hasRole('USER')")
public User getCurrentUser() {
// get user logic
}
@PreAuthorize("hasAnyRole('ADMIN', 'MANAGER')")
public List<User> listAllUsers() {
// list logic
}
}
// Unit test
import org.junit.jupiter.api.Test;
import org.springframework.security.test.context.support.WithMockUser;
import static org.assertj.core.api.Assertions.*;
class UserServiceSecurityTest {
@Test
@WithMockUser(roles = "ADMIN")
void shouldAllowAdminToDeleteUser() {
UserService service = new UserService();
assertThatCode(() -> service.deleteUser(1L))
.doesNotThrowAnyException();
}
@Test
@WithMockUser(roles = "USER")
void shouldDenyUserFromDeletingUser() {
UserService service = new UserService();
assertThatThrownBy(() -> service.deleteUser(1L))
.isInstanceOf(AccessDeniedException.class);
}
@Test
@WithMockUser(roles = "ADMIN")
void shouldAllowAdminAndManagerToListUsers() {
UserService service = new UserService();
assertThatCode(() -> service.listAllUsers())
.doesNotThrowAnyException();
}
@Test
void shouldDenyAnonymousUserAccess() {
UserService service = new UserService();
assertThatThrownBy(() -> service.deleteUser(1L))
.isInstanceOf(AccessDeniedException.class);
}
}
```

## Testing Controller Security with MockMvc
### Secure REST Endpoints
```java
@RestController
@RequestMapping("/api/admin")
public class AdminController {
@GetMapping("/users")
@PreAuthorize("hasRole('ADMIN')")
public List<UserDto> listAllUsers() {
// logic
}
@DeleteMapping("/users/{id}")
@PreAuthorize("hasRole('ADMIN')")
public void deleteUser(@PathVariable Long id) {
// delete logic
}
}
// Testing with MockMvc
import org.springframework.security.test.context.support.WithMockUser;
import static org.springframework.security.test.web.servlet.request.SecurityMockMvcRequestPostProcessors.*;
import static org.springframework.test.web.servlet.request.MockMvcRequestBuilders.*;
import static org.springframework.test.web.servlet.result.MockMvcResultMatchers.*;
class AdminControllerSecurityTest {
private MockMvc mockMvc;
@BeforeEach
void setUp() {
mockMvc = MockMvcBuilders
.standaloneSetup(new AdminController())
.apply(springSecurity())
.build();
}
@Test
@WithMockUser(roles = "ADMIN")
void shouldAllowAdminToListUsers() throws Exception {
mockMvc.perform(get("/api/admin/users"))
.andExpect(status().isOk());
}
@Test
@WithMockUser(roles = "USER")
void shouldDenyUserFromListingUsers() throws Exception {
mockMvc.perform(get("/api/admin/users"))
.andExpect(status().isForbidden());
}
@Test
void shouldDenyAnonymousAccessToAdminEndpoint() throws Exception {
mockMvc.perform(get("/api/admin/users"))
.andExpect(status().isUnauthorized());
}
@Test
@WithMockUser(roles = "ADMIN")
void shouldAllowAdminToDeleteUser() throws Exception {
mockMvc.perform(delete("/api/admin/users/1"))
.andExpect(status().isOk());
}
}
```

## Testing Custom Permission Evaluator
### Create and Test Custom Permission Logic
```java
// Custom permission evaluator
@Component
public class DocumentPermissionEvaluator implements PermissionEvaluator {
private final DocumentRepository documentRepository;
public DocumentPermissionEvaluator(DocumentRepository documentRepository) {
this.documentRepository = documentRepository;
}
@Override
public boolean hasPermission(Authentication authentication, Object targetDomainObject, Object permission) {
if (authentication == null) return false;
Document document = (Document) targetDomainObject;
String userUsername = authentication.getName();
return document.getOwner().getUsername().equals(userUsername) ||
userHasRole(authentication, "ADMIN");
}
@Override
public boolean hasPermission(Authentication authentication, Serializable targetId, String targetType, Object permission) {
if (authentication == null) return false;
if (!"Document".equals(targetType)) return false;
Document document = documentRepository.findById((Long) targetId).orElse(null);
if (document == null) return false;
return hasPermission(authentication, document, permission);
}
private boolean userHasRole(Authentication authentication, String role) {
return authentication.getAuthorities().stream()
.anyMatch(auth -> auth.getAuthority().equals("ROLE_" + role));
}
}
// Unit test for custom evaluator
class DocumentPermissionEvaluatorTest {
private DocumentPermissionEvaluator evaluator;
private DocumentRepository documentRepository;
private Authentication adminAuth;
private Authentication userAuth;
private Document document;
@BeforeEach
void setUp() {
documentRepository = mock(DocumentRepository.class);
evaluator = new DocumentPermissionEvaluator(documentRepository);
document = new Document(1L, "Test Doc", new User("alice"));
adminAuth = new UsernamePasswordAuthenticationToken(
"admin",
null,
List.of(new SimpleGrantedAuthority("ROLE_ADMIN"))
);
userAuth = new UsernamePasswordAuthenticationToken(
"alice",
null,
List.of(new SimpleGrantedAuthority("ROLE_USER"))
);
}
@Test
void shouldGrantPermissionToDocumentOwner() {
boolean hasPermission = evaluator.hasPermission(userAuth, document, "WRITE");
assertThat(hasPermission).isTrue();
}
@Test
void shouldDenyPermissionToNonOwner() {
Authentication otherUserAuth = new UsernamePasswordAuthenticationToken(
"bob",
null,
List.of(new SimpleGrantedAuthority("ROLE_USER"))
);
boolean hasPermission = evaluator.hasPermission(otherUserAuth, document, "WRITE");
assertThat(hasPermission).isFalse();
}
@Test
void shouldGrantPermissionToAdmin() {
boolean hasPermission = evaluator.hasPermission(adminAuth, document, "WRITE");
assertThat(hasPermission).isTrue();
}
@Test
void shouldDenyNullAuthentication() {
boolean hasPermission = evaluator.hasPermission(null, document, "WRITE");
assertThat(hasPermission).isFalse();
}
}
```

## Best Practices
- **Use @WithMockUser** for setting authenticated user context
- **Test both allow and deny cases** for each security rule
- **Test with different roles** to verify role-based decisions
- **Test expression-based security** comprehensively
- **Mock external dependencies** (permission evaluators, etc.)
- **Test anonymous access separately** from authenticated access
- **Use @EnableGlobalMethodSecurity** in configuration for method-level security
## Common Pitfalls
- Forgetting to enable method security in test configuration
- Not testing both allow and deny scenarios
- Testing framework code instead of authorization logic
- Not handling null authentication in tests
- Mixing authentication and authorization tests unnecessarily
## Constraints and Warnings
- **Method security requires proxy**: @PreAuthorize works via proxies; direct method calls bypass security
- **@EnableGlobalMethodSecurity**: Must be enabled for @PreAuthorize, @Secured to work
- **Role prefix**: Spring adds "ROLE_" prefix automatically; use hasRole('ADMIN') not hasRole('ROLE_ADMIN')
- **Authentication context**: Security context is thread-local; be careful with async tests
- **@WithMockUser limitations**: Creates a simple Authentication; complex auth scenarios need custom setup
- **SpEL expressions**: Complex SpEL in @PreAuthorize can be difficult to debug; test thoroughly
- **Performance impact**: Method security adds overhead; consider security at layer boundaries

## Constraints and Warnings
**AccessDeniedException not thrown**: Ensure `@EnableGlobalMethodSecurity(prePostEnabled = true)` is configured.
**@WithMockUser not working**: Verify Spring Security test dependencies are on classpath.
**Custom PermissionEvaluator not invoked**: Check `@EnableGlobalMethodSecurity(securedEnabled = true, prePostEnabled = true)`.
